The Anatomy of Shoulder Pain and Why Heat Helps
The shoulder is the most complex joint in the human body, capable of more degrees of movement than any other articulation. This mobility comes at a cost. The shoulder relies on a delicate balance of muscles, tendons, ligaments, and bursae rather than a deep ball-and-socket structure like the hip. The rotator cuff, a group of four muscles and their tendons, holds the head of the humerus securely against the glenoid fossa while allowing the arm to rotate, elevate, and reach. The trapezius, levator scapulae, and rhomboid muscles anchor the shoulder blade to the spine and provide the postural foundation upon which shoulder movement depends. When any of these structures becomes irritated, inflamed, or injured, the pain radiates across a broad area that can be difficult to localize.
Heat therapy addresses shoulder pain through multiple well-established physiological mechanisms. When you apply an electric heating wrap for shoulders, the warmth causes blood vessels in the skin and underlying muscles to dilate. This vasodilation increases blood flow to the area, delivering oxygen and nutrients while removing inflammatory byproducts and metabolic waste that accumulate in tense tissues. The improved circulation helps relax tight muscle fibers that have been holding tension in a protective response to pain or overuse. Warmth reduces the viscosity of synovial fluid within the glenohumeral joint, allowing for smoother movement and less friction during range of motion exercises. Additionally, heat stimulates sensory nerve fibers that compete with pain signals for attention in the spinal cord, effectively reducing the perception of discomfort. These effects combine to create a therapeutic environment that promotes healing, reduces stiffness, and prepares the shoulder for gentle rehabilitation.
How Electric Heating Wraps Differ from Standard Heating Pads
Traditional heating pads are flat, rectangular devices designed for general use on the back, abdomen, or legs. While they can be draped over a shoulder, they rarely conform well to the complex contours of the upper body. They slip off during movement, bunch up under clothing, and leave gaps where heat escapes rather than penetrating the target tissues. Electric heating wraps for shoulders represent a specialized evolution that addresses these limitations through thoughtful design. The most fundamental difference is shape. Shoulder wraps are contoured to follow the anatomy of the upper torso, with curved panels that drape across the trapezius, extend over the deltoid, and tuck around the neck to capture the levator scapulae and upper rhomboids. This anatomical fit ensures that heat is delivered precisely where shoulder pain originates rather than being wasted on surrounding areas.
The fastening mechanism is another critical distinction. Standard heating pads rely on gravity or manual pressure to maintain contact, which is impractical for a body part that moves with every breath and gesture. Shoulder wraps use adjustable straps, hook-and-loop closures, or weighted designs that secure the device in place without requiring constant readjustment. Some models fasten across the chest with a single strap, while others use a vest-like configuration with side closures that distribute weight evenly. The secure fit allows you to walk, stretch, or perform gentle household tasks while receiving continuous heat therapy, transforming treatment from a sedentary activity into a mobile support system. The electric heating wrap for shoulders thus liberates you from the couch, enabling therapeutic warmth while you move through your day.
Material selection also differentiates quality shoulder wraps from basic alternatives. The inner surface that contacts your skin should be soft, breathable, and capable of distributing heat evenly without creating hot spots. Microplush fabrics provide a gentle, luxurious feel that encourages extended use, while moisture-wicking materials prevent the clammy sensation that can develop during longer sessions. The heating element itself may be embedded wires, carbon fiber panels, or infrared technology. Wire-based systems heat quickly and offer precise temperature control but can create localized hot spots if the wire spacing is uneven. Carbon fiber provides more uniform heat distribution across the entire surface. Infrared technology penetrates deeper into tissues, warming muscles and joints below the surface rather than merely heating the skin. Each technology has its strengths, and the best choice depends on your specific symptoms and preferences.
Selecting the Right Features for Your Needs
The market for shoulder heating wraps has expanded dramatically, and the range of available features can be overwhelming. Understanding which features genuinely enhance therapy and which are merely marketing additions helps you invest wisely. Temperature control is the most important functional feature. The best wraps offer multiple heat settings, typically ranging from low temperatures around ninety degrees Fahrenheit to high settings approaching one hundred fifty degrees. Your ideal temperature depends on your comfort tolerance, the severity of your symptoms, and whether you are using the wrap over clothing or directly on skin. Look for models with clearly labeled settings and a digital display that shows the current temperature. Automatic shut-off timers are a non-negotiable safety feature, with most quality wraps including two-hour auto shut-off to prevent overheating and conserve energy.
Moist heat capability is a valuable feature that many users overlook. Moist heat penetrates tissue more effectively than dry heat because water conducts thermal energy efficiently. Some electric wraps include a sponge insert that you dampen before use, while others are designed to be used with a moistened cloth barrier. The moisture helps the heat reach deeper into the muscle layers of the shoulder girdle, where much of the tension and guarding originates. If you have access to a moist heat option, experiment with both dry and moist applications to determine which provides better relief for your specific symptoms. Some users find that moist heat is more effective for deep muscle relaxation, while dry heat feels more comfortable for extended sessions.
Size and coverage area should match your body and your pain pattern. People with broad shoulders or extensive upper back involvement need wraps with larger panels that extend across the full width of the trapezius and down toward the thoracic spine. Those with more localized pain, such as isolated rotator cuff discomfort, may prefer smaller wraps that concentrate heat on the deltoid and lateral shoulder without overwhelming the neck. Adjustable straps are essential for achieving a custom fit, as shoulder dimensions vary significantly between individuals. The wrap should feel snug but not restrictive, with even contact across the entire heated surface. Gaps between the wrap and your skin allow heat to escape and reduce therapeutic effectiveness. Using Your Shoulder Wrap Safely and Effectively
Safety must guide every aspect of heat therapy, and the shoulder region presents specific considerations that differ from heating the lower back or abdomen. The skin of the neck and upper chest is often thinner and more sensitive than skin on the back, which means you may feel excessive heat more quickly. Start with the lowest temperature setting and gradually increase as needed, particularly if you are new to shoulder heat therapy or if you have reduced sensation due to diabetes, neuropathy, or certain medications. Never use the highest setting for more than twenty minutes at a time, and never place the wrap directly on bare skin without first testing the temperature on your forearm. A layer of thin cotton clothing provides a protective barrier that moderates heat transfer while still allowing therapeutic penetration.
Timing your heat therapy sessions can significantly impact their effectiveness. For acute shoulder strain, such as discomfort that follows a specific incident like lifting something heavy or sleeping awkwardly, heat is most beneficial after the initial inflammatory phase has subsided. During the first twenty-four to forty-eight hours after an acute injury, cold therapy is generally preferred because it reduces inflammation and numbs pain. After this period, heat becomes the better choice because it promotes healing circulation and relaxes protective muscle spasms. For chronic shoulder tension, heat can be used at any time, though many people find it most helpful in the morning to loosen stiffness that accumulated overnight, or in the evening to unwind tension from the day. Using an electric heating wrap for shoulders before physical activity can also serve as a warm-up, increasing tissue elasticity and reducing the risk of further strain during exercise or manual tasks.
Positioning during treatment matters as well. The wrap should cover the entire area of discomfort, which may extend from the base of the skull down to the mid-back and across to the front of the shoulder. If your wrap is too small to cover this entire region, prioritize the areas where pain is most intense and move the wrap to capture secondary areas during subsequent sessions. Maintain good posture while wearing the wrap, as slumping forward stretches the heated tissues in a lengthened position that may reduce the therapeutic effect. Sit upright with your shoulder blades gently drawn together, or lie on your back with a pillow supporting your neck. These positions allow the heat to work on tissues that are in a neutral, relaxed state rather than under postural strain.
Integrating Heat Therapy With Shoulder Rehabilitation
A heating wrap is a powerful tool, but it works best as part of a comprehensive approach to shoulder health. The most effective strategy combines heat with movement, because warmth prepares tissues for activity while movement maintains the mobility that heat restores. After a fifteen to twenty minute heat session, perform gentle range of motion exercises that take the shoulder through its available movement without forcing into pain. Pendulum swings, where you lean forward and allow the arm to dangle and circle gently, help lubricate the joint and prevent the adhesions that develop with immobility. Wall walks, where you walk your fingers up a wall as high as comfortable, restore elevation without requiring active muscle contraction against gravity. Cross-body stretches, where you bring the arm across the chest and gently press it closer with the opposite hand, address the posterior capsule tightness that contributes to impingement.
Strengthening exercises build the muscular support that protects the shoulder from future strain. The rotator cuff muscles respond well to low-resistance, high-repetition exercises using light dumbbells or resistance bands. External rotation, internal rotation, and scaption movements target the four rotator cuff muscles in isolation, while rows and shoulder presses integrate the shoulder into larger movement patterns. These exercises should be performed pain-free, with heat therapy used before sessions to prepare the tissues and after sessions to manage any mild soreness that develops. The combination of heat and structured exercise creates a virtuous cycle where each modality enhances the other. The electric heating wrap for shoulders becomes not merely a comfort device but a rehabilitation tool that enables the active recovery necessary for lasting improvement.
Posture correction throughout the day reduces the mechanical stress that perpetuates shoulder tension. If you work at a desk, position your monitor at eye level so that you do not crane your neck forward, which elevates the shoulder blade and compresses the structures beneath it. Keep your keyboard close enough that your elbows remain near your sides rather than reaching forward, which strains the upper trapezius. Take standing breaks every thirty minutes to reset your spinal alignment and activate the muscles that become inhibited during sitting. When carrying bags or backpacks, distribute weight evenly and avoid single-shoulder bags that create asymmetrical loading. These habits, combined with regular heat therapy, address the root causes of shoulder pain rather than merely managing its symptoms.
What to Expect and When to Seek Professional Help
Realistic expectations are essential for any home therapy. Heat therapy provides temporary relief by improving circulation and relaxing muscles, but it does not repair torn tendons, reverse arthritis, or correct structural abnormalities. The goal is to manage symptoms, improve function, and create conditions that support healing, not to eliminate the underlying condition entirely. Most people notice some improvement within the first ten to fifteen minutes of a heat session, with the full effect developing over twenty to thirty minutes. The relief typically lasts for several hours after the session ends, though this varies depending on the severity of your symptoms and what activities you engage in afterward.
If you have used a heating wrap consistently for two weeks without noticeable improvement, consider adjusting your approach. You may need a different type of heat, such as switching from dry heat to moist heat or trying an infrared model for deeper penetration. You may need to combine heat with more targeted stretching or strengthening exercises. You may need to address ergonomic factors in your workspace that are perpetuating your discomfort. Alternatively, your symptoms may indicate a condition that requires professional evaluation and treatment beyond what home therapy can provide. An electric heating wrap for shoulders should be a first-line tool, but it should not delay appropriate medical care when symptoms are severe, progressive, or accompanied by neurological signs.
Seek professional evaluation if your shoulder pain is accompanied by weakness, numbness, or tingling in the arm or hand, as these symptoms may indicate nerve compression that requires targeted intervention. Pain that wakes you from sleep, pain that persists at rest, or pain that significantly limits your range of motion may indicate structural damage such as a rotator cuff tear or adhesive capsulitis that responds best to clinical treatment. A physical therapist can assess your specific shoulder mechanics, identify the tissues responsible for your pain, and design a rehabilitation program that integrates heat therapy appropriately. An orthopedic specialist can evaluate whether imaging studies are needed to rule out serious pathology. The goal is to use your heating wrap as part of a coordinated care plan rather than as a substitute for professional diagnosis and treatment.
